Default Exporting Members on a distribution list

Folks here is a question, you know how you select a distribution list and
then you click on Properties you can see all the member name in full. I
want to know how I can export the names of people who are part of that
distribution list to a excel or text file? Is there a way, I don't want to
do this in AD only because in AD it only shows the users login name as
oppose to their fullnames. Thanks in Advance.

Open the DL and click FileSave As. Save it as a text file. This will
create a tab-separated values file that Excel can open.

That works on an Outlook personal DL. WooYing would need to use a script or tool to extract the DL members from the DLs in AD. See http://www.slipstick.com/contacts/dl.htm#tools and http://www.slipstick.com/contacts/print.htm#gal
